- He presents shows on BBC Radio 2 ("Bob Harris Show" on Saturdays and "Bob Harris Country" on Thursdays) and he was one of the original presenters on BBC 6 Music.
- Presented the award for Best Traditional Track to The Imagined Village, for Cold Haily Rainy Night, at the BBC Radio 2 Folk Awards. (4th February 2008).
- Won a Sony Award for 'Music Broadcaster of the Year'.
- In 2003 he received the Radio Academy/PRS award for 'Outstanding Contribution to Music Radio'.
- John Thomson admitted that his character Louis Balfour in The Fast Show (1994) was conceived as a cross between Bob and the actor Roger Moore.
- He was awarded the OBE (Officer of the Order of the British Empire) in the 2011 Queen's Birthday Honors List for his services to Music Broadcasting. He is a radio presenter.
